Description

The new Transilon Type E 12/3 U0/U10 MT black has been developed for applications in the recycling industry and is used in particular for sorting or separating waste using optical sensors (NIR, X-rays ). The black matte pvc top face guarantees less light reflection required for use on conveyors with optical sensors. The robust triple-ply design reduces the risk destroying the belt if hard or sharp products damage it accidentally. The top layer fabric’s black, therefore ensuring disruption-free sorting – even until replacement of an accidentally damaged belt. Applications • Sorting center / separating machine systems • Optical sensors, NIR sorting • X-ray • Sorting after label remover (de-labeler) • Infeed / outfeed and transfer Properties/Advantages • Polyvinyl chloride Shore A 83 top coating => excellent wear resistance • Color black and surface matt => minimal light reflection (optical sensor) • 3-plies belt construction => robust and resistant to sharp steel edges, long service life • Smooth running at high speed • Black color PE fabric on 1st layer => ensures continuous sorting operation, even if the top coating delaminated by accident until replacement gets ready
